def create_docker_container()

in composer_local_dev/environment.py [0:0]


    def create_docker_container(self):
        """Creates docker container.

        Raises when docker container with the same name already exists.
        """
        LOG.debug("Creating container")
        db_extras = self.database_extras
        grouped_db_mounts = db_extras["mounts"]
        db_mounts = {
            **grouped_db_mounts['files'],
            **grouped_db_mounts['folders'],
        }
        mounts = get_image_mounts(
            self.env_dir_path,
            self.dags_path,
            utils.resolve_gcloud_config_path(),
            utils.resolve_kube_config_path(),
            self.requirements_file,
            db_mounts,
        )
        db_vars = db_extras["env_vars"]
        default_vars = get_default_environment_variables(
            self.dag_dir_list_interval, self.project_id, db_vars
        )
        env_vars = {**default_vars, **self.environment_vars}
        if (
                platform.system() == "Windows"
                and env_vars["COMPOSER_CONTAINER_RUN_AS_HOST_USER"] == "True"
        ):
            raise Exception(
                "COMPOSER_CONTAINER_RUN_AS_HOST_USER must be set to `False` on Windows"
            )

        ports = {
            f"8080/tcp": self.port,
        }
        entrypoint = f"sh {constants.ENTRYPOINT_PATH}"
        memory_limit = constants.DOCKER_CONTAINER_MEMORY_LIMIT

        try:
            container = self.create_container(
                image=self.image_tag,
                name=self.container_name,
                entrypoint=entrypoint,
                environment=env_vars,
                mounts=mounts,
                ports=ports,
                mem_limit=memory_limit,
                detach=True,
            )
        except docker_errors.ImageNotFound:
            LOG.debug(
                "Failed to create container with ImageNotFound error. "
                "Pulling the image..."
            )
            self.pull_image()
            container = self.create_container(
                image=self.image_tag,
                name=self.container_name,
                entrypoint=entrypoint,
                environment=env_vars,
                mounts=mounts,
                ports=ports,
                mem_limit=memory_limit,
                detach=True,
            )
        except docker_errors.APIError as err:
            error = f"Failed to create container with an error: {err}"
            if is_mount_permission_error(err):
                error += constants.DOCKER_PERMISSION_ERROR_HINT.format(
                    docs_faq_url=constants.COMPOSER_FAQ_MOUNTING_LINK
                )
            raise errors.EnvironmentStartError(error)
        copy_to_container(container, self.entrypoint_file)
        copy_to_container(container, self.run_file)
        return container
